Poplar Grey
Subacronicta megacephala

([Denis & Schiffermüller], 1775) 2278 / 73.046
=Acronicta megacephala

Norfolk status
Widespread.
Woodland, fens, heathland, scrub, grassland and gardens.
Similar to the Sycamore moth. Distinctive round stigma and white patch on the forewing, with whitish hindwings.

Recorded in 67 (91%) of 74 10k Squares.
First Recorded in 1834.
Last Recorded in 2024.

Forewing: 17-20mm.
Flight: One generation May-Aug.
Foodplant:   Poplars, Aspen and willows
Red List: Least Concern (LC)
GB Status: Common
